so whats the consensus on a PSU for the ants / what's the most popular choice...? what sort of wattage do you need for factory and / or OC'd units...?

If you have some spare time for modding, server psu is the cheapest choice that you can find (Dell PSUs are the most used)

i really don't have any time to dedicate to modding... just looking for a cheap PnP... what wattage is recommended for factory or OC'd ants...?

It's not so much wattage, it's amperage on the 12V rail.  An OC'd S1 uses about 32-33amps on a gold PSU on a 115v line.  Make sure whatever you get has enough juice on the 12V line to run as many Ants as you are looking for, and you should be fine.

thanks for the info... seems like wifi is my only option for now... unless i can set these up in my brothers place and hardware them in... any suggestions for hubs since his router can only host 5 ethernet cables? that being said is there a link for some quality antennas i can pick up if i can't set these up @ my brothers place?

also this is the rack i was looking at http://www.canadiantire.ca/en/pdp/3-tier-chrome-wire-shelf-0680324p.html#.U2zDL1f_lVY simple and basic for only 8 units... would that work or no?

Rather than WiFi, if you can't get an Ethernet cable from the miner back to your router consider using a couple of network over powerline adapters.  I use a couple of Trendnet AV500 adapters to get networking to a streaming media box in my kitchen.  Works like a charm and averages about 190Mbs.  Much better connection than WiFi.  If I ever pull the gun on a S1 it will end up in my basement on another AV500 adapter.

quite interesting but how would that work for 8 units? would i need 9 adapters total? one for the router and the other 8 for the miners?

No, just put a switch in.  You can pickup 8-port 100Mbps switches for dirt cheap these days, as low as $10 on Newegg.  Run the miners to the switch and one cable from the switch to the AV500 adapter.  Since you are going to have 8 miners you will need to switches, but Ethernet can handle chaining switches up to a point.  As for the powerline network adapters, here is a set for under $42.

[router] -- [power adapter] -- [house wiring] -- [power adapter] -- [switch] -- [Ant x 7]

i may just invest in a 16 port switch... eliminates the need for 2 of them and allows me to have the capability of adding a few more miners if i purchase more after the initial 8... thanks for all the help...
